Understanding the LMM Duramax Emissions System

The LMM Duramax, produced from 2007.5 to 2010, marked GM’s first full step into diesel particulate filter territory. That single addition changed how the engine operated, how it made power, and how it aged.

From the factory, the LMM emissions system includes:

  • A diesel particulate filter (DPF)
  • Exhaust gas recirculation (EGR)
  • Multiple exhaust temperature sensors
  • Differential pressure sensors
  • Regeneration logic built into the ECM

The purpose of the DPF is to trap soot and burn it off during regeneration cycles. Over time, however, this process becomes less efficient as sensors age, injectors wear, and exhaust flow becomes more restricted. According to Wikipedia’s technical overview of diesel particulate filters, DPF systems rely heavily on sustained exhaust temperatures and precise feedback loops, which explains why older platforms like the LMM tend to struggle as mileage climbs and components degrade.

When those systems begin to fail, the truck compensates by running more regens, injecting more fuel, and driving exhaust temperatures higher than necessary. That’s when drivability and reliability start to suffer.

What a DPF Delete Really Means on an LMM

A DPF delete is more than just removing a filter from the exhaust. It changes how the engine breathes, how it manages heat, and how the ECM interprets operating conditions.

Physically, the DPF section of the exhaust is replaced with a straight-through pipe intended for off-road use. But removing the hardware without recalibrating the software creates immediate problems.

Without tuning:

  • The ECM still commands regeneration events
  • Fault codes appear
  • Fueling becomes erratic
  • Limp mode is triggered

That’s exactly why EFI Live is a required part of any proper lmm dpf delete efi live setup.

Removing emissions equipment is not legal for vehicles operated on public roads. The U.S. Environmental Protection Agency (EPA) enforces emissions regulations under the Clean Air Act, which clearly states that tampering with emissions systems on highway vehicles is prohibited, regardless of vehicle age.
